A Level 2 Electrician is not your daily sparky. Their license grants them the authority to deal with the electrical service network straight connected to the primary power grid, right as much as the consumer's point of supply. This encompasses a broad and typically harmful series of tasks that standard electricians are merely not allowed to undertake. Think of it: when your power goes out, or when a brand-new connection is required for a development, it's these specialists who are called upon to connect with the high-voltage infrastructure that powers our modern lives.
Their scope of work is substantial and requires an extensive understanding of electrical systems, strict safety procedures, and often, an ability to work in challenging environments. This can consist of jobs such as disconnecting and reconnecting service lines, installing and updating service mains, and performing repair work to harmed overhead and underground service lines. They are likewise responsible for the installation of new metering devices, making sure that intake is accurately determined and reported. In addition, if you're looking to install a brand-new solar power system or incorporate any other kind of renewable resource into the grid, a Level 2 Electrician is essential for the crucial connection points.
The training and accreditation required to become a Level 2 Electrician are extensive, showing the high-stakes nature of their work. It's not just about passing an exam; it includes extensive on-the-job experience under the supervision of already certified professionals, combined with specialized training courses focusing on network guidelines, safety guidelines, and the technical complexities of dealing with live high-voltage systems. This typically implies extra professional education systems beyond the basic electrical trade certification, demonstrating a commitment to continuous knowing and expert advancement. The focus on safety is relentless, as even a small misstep can have disastrous effects, not only for the electrician themselves but likewise for the wider neighborhood and the stability of the electrical network.
